Hilal and 3 others in quarters
By Mohammed Al-Kinani
Published in The Saudi Gazette on 05 - 02 - 2010

Hilal, Al-Nasr, Al-Shabab and Al-Ahli booked their Crown Prince Cup quarterfinals berths Thursday.
Defending champion Al-Hilal beat visitors Al-Faisali 2-1; Al-Nasr beat host Al-Ra'id 2-0; Al-Shabab defeated its host Al-Qadisiyah 2-1; while Al-Ahli edged its host Hajr 3-2.
In Riyadh Christian Wilhelmsson put Hilal in front 11 minutes into the second half when the Swedish midfielder diverted a cross into the goal. Hilal had its rival player Aqeel Bulghaith to thank for the winner when he scored an own goal in the 70th minute.
Abdul Aziz Fallata scored the guest team's only goal two minutes from time.
In the Nasr-Ra'id match, Egyptian Nasr Hosam Ghali double was enough to secure a win for Nasr.
Nasr will meet Hilal in the quarterfinals Wednesday.
Al-Shabab edged its host Al-Qadisiyah 2-1. Peruvian midfielder Juan Elias Cominges put Qadisiyah in the lead in the 30th minute but goals from Waleed Al-Jaizani and Marcelo Camacho handed Shabab the win.
Shabab will meet the winner of Friday's match between Al-Wehdah and Al-Ta'ee in the quarterfinal match on Tuesday.
In another match, Al-Ahli beat Hajr 3-2. Strong winds affected the result.
Husain Al-Rahib put Ahli in the lead seven minutes into the match. Mohammed Musa'ad added another in the 22nd minute, while Brazilian Victor Simoes sealed the win with a goal in the 38th minute.
The host's goals came through Mubarak Al-Khudhari and Kamil Al-Mu'adhin.
Al-Ahli will meet Al-Fateh in the quarterfinals on Tuesday after the latter had won over Al-Ittifaq 3-1 Wednesday.
